text by Catherine D. Hughes. text by Catherine D. Hughes by Catherine D. Hughes. text by Katherine Eaves Catherine D. Hughes. text by Katherine Bullock text by Catherine Calvert text by Catherine Pierce Catherine D. Hughes Catherine A.Hughes